Jeramia, of Hebrew origin, means 'praised highly by God' or 'exalted by God'. It is a variant of the name Jeremiah, which is deeply rooted in biblical tradition, symbolizing divine favor and spiritual elevation. The name carries a sense of reverence and is often chosen for its profound spiritual connotations.
